Doctor De Soto

Written by William Steig

Illustrated by William Steig


Reviewed by O.B. (age 8)


Doctor De Soto

Doctor De Soto was a mouse that was a dentist. He would not treat animals that hurt him. One day there was a fox with a bandage around his jaw. Doctor De Soto did not want to treat that fox but the fox convinced Doctor De Soto to help him. The fox wanted to eat Doctor De Soto and his wife. His wife made him a new tooth. Then the fox came back and the De Sotos were going to fix him but they tricked the fox. Instead of curing him they gave him sticky glue so he couldn't open him mouth. He couldn't eat them. Then the fox went home.

I liked Doctor De Soto because he was brave. I felt worried as I read the book because the fox wanted to eat Doctor De Soto and his wife. My favorite part was when the fox went home. I think Doctor De Soto is a fantastic book.

Other people should read this book because it is entertaining. I think this book is for second graders. It might interest readers because one of the characters is mean and the other characters are kind yet sneaky!
